2. Choose the Right Moisturizer
Not all moisturizers are created equal. Look for products that contain key ingredients like hyaluronic acid, glycerin, or ceramides. These ingredients attract and lock moisture into your skin, creating a barrier against dryness.
How to Find Your Perfect Match:
- Skin Type Matters: Oily skin may benefit from a lightweight gel, while dry skin needs a richer cream.
- Check the Labels: Avoid products with alcohol or harsh chemicals that can strip your skin of its natural oils.
3. Exfoliate Regularly
Exfoliation is an essential step in achieving radiant skin. It helps remove dead skin cells, allowing fresh, new skin to shine through. However, moderation is key; over-exfoliating can lead to irritation.

Types of Exfoliants:
- Physical Exfoliants: Scrubs with natural ingredients like sugar or coffee.
- Chemical Exfoliants: Products containing AHAs or BHAs that dissolve dead skin cells.

5. Don’t Skip Sunscreen
Protecting your skin from harmful UV rays is non-negotiable. Sunscreen helps prevent skin damage and premature aging. Choose a broad-spectrum SPF 30 or higher and apply it daily, even when it’s cloudy.
Best Practices:
- Reapply every two hours when outdoors.
- Use it even on overcast days—UV rays can penetrate clouds.
